Barcamp Ethiopia 2011 is the second large Barcamp to be organized in Ethiopia, the follow-up to last years successful Barcamp at EiABC in Addis.
A Barcamp is a sort of "unconference" (BAR= "Beyond All Recognition"): It is organized and administered not by an institution or a company, but by an open community of interested individuals. It has no pre-structured program - everything is planned and coordinated through a web-based public Wiki (the page you are visiting right now) and other online tools where anyone can post ideas and participate actively through collaboration. So far, over 400 Barcamps have been held all over the world with different thematic focus, also in several other African countries, but until last year, never before in Ethiopia.
